免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

怎么用微信开发工具开发小程序

微信开发工具是微信官方提供的一款用于开发小程序的专用开发工具。利用微信开发工具,开发者可以方便地编辑、预览和调试小程序,加速小程序的开发过程,并且提升开发效率,本文将为大家详细介绍如何使用微信开发工具开发小程序。

一、微信开发工具的安装和配置

1.安装微信开发工具

可以在微信公众平台的"小程序开发"选项下,下载对应操作系统的安装包。安装成功后,打开微信开发工具,在登录框中使用微信账号进行登录即可。

2.配置小程序的基本信息

登录微信后,打开微信开发工具。在左上方"新建"下选择"小程序项目",在弹出的"新建小程序"的提示框中填写基本信息,包括项目名称、AppID、项目路径、需要勾选"使用npm模块"选项等信息。

二、微信小程序项目的文件结构

1.项目结构

微信小程序项目的根目录下包含app.json、app.js和app.wxss,其中app.json为小程序全局配置文件,app.js为小程序生命周期函数文件,app.wxss为小程序全局样式文件;在每个页面对应的文件夹中包含有相应的.json、.js、.wxml和.wxss四个文件,分别对应该页面的配置文件、逻辑代码、视图文件和样式文件。

2.页面生命周期函数

在小程序中的每个页面都有自己对应的生命周期函数,即onLoad、onShow、onReady、onHide、onUnload等函数。其中,onLoad函数为页面加载时触发的函数,onShow函数为页面显示时触发的函数,onReady函数为页面渲染完毕时触发的函数,onHide函数为页面隐藏时触发的函数,onUnload函数为页面卸载时触发的函数。

三、微信开发工具的使用

1.编辑小程序的代码

在微信开发工具中,可以打开小程序的界面编辑器和代码编辑器,通过拖拽组件,可使整个小程序构建更加简单、快捷。对于需要使用自定义组件的小程序,可以使用组件的WXML和WXSS文件进行自定义。

2.预览小程序

编辑完小程序之后,还可以在微信开发工具中进行预览,即点击"预览"按钮,扫描弹出的二维码即可在手机上查看小程序的效果。

3.调试小程序

在微信开发工具中,开发者可以进行小程序的调试,调试的形式有真机调试和模拟器调试。

模拟器调试是针对模拟器中的小程序,在开发时可以更加方便,无需频繁在手机和电脑之间切换,也不需要担心真机测试带来的不便。模拟器调试弥补了真机调试的不足之处,方便了开发及测试过程。

四、小程序的上线

小程序开发完成后可以进入微信公众平台的"开发管理"中进行小程序的发布和上线。

1.提交代码审核

在小程序开发完成后,需要进行小程序的审核。将小程序的代码打包,进行提交审核即可,等待信息员审核。如果审核通过,小程序可以上线;如果审核不通过,则需要修复完毕后再次提交审核。

2.小程序的上线

当小程序审核通过后,即可在微信公众平台上线,让用户进行使用。

以上就是微信开发工具开发小程序的基本流程及技巧,使用微信开发工具可以让开发者更加方便地进行小程序的开发,也可以加快小程序的开发速度。


相关知识:
百度小程序开发产龙动物园
百度小程序开发产龙动物园是一个非常有趣和富有创意的项目。它结合了百度小程序的强大功能和动物园主题,为用户提供了一种独特的动物园体验。在这篇文章中,我将为您详细介绍百度小程序开发产龙动物园的原理和实现方法。一、产龙动物园的概述产龙动物园是一个虚拟的动物园,用
2023-08-23
安徽商店小程序开发定制价格
安徽商店小程序开发定制价格是指为企业、机构等定制化开发适用于其商店销售的小程序所涉及的费用。开发一款商店小程序需要付出的成本包括开发人力、软件工具、服务器费用等等。本文主要介绍商店小程序的开发原理以及定制价格的相关因素。商店小程序的开发原理商店小程序的开发
2023-08-09
安卓微信小程序快速开发
安卓微信小程序是一款基于微信平台的应用程序,由微信公众平台开发者服务团队推出。与传统的安卓应用程序不同,安卓微信小程序无需下载安装即可在微信内部使用。开发安卓微信小程序需要掌握以下几个方面的知识:1. 小程序开发基础首先,需要掌握小程序开发基础知识,如小程
2023-08-09
react框架开发微信小程序
React是一个非常流行的JavaScript库,用于构建各种应用程序。随着微信小程序越来越流行,很多人也开始尝试在React中开发微信小程序。本文将对React框架开发微信小程序进行详细介绍和原理解析。一、微信小程序介绍微信小程序是一种应用程序,类似于手
2023-08-09
php小程序开发啊全部课程
PHP小程序开发是一个相对较新的技能,但已经成为了Web开发的关键。它提供了一种轻便、灵活和安全的方式来快速开发应用程序和网站。下面将详细介绍 PHP 小程序开发的全部课程及其原理。1. PHP小程序简介PHP小程序是一种基于PHP语言的微型程序框架,它利
2023-08-09
h5小程序微信开发
H5小程序微信开发是一种在微信中运行的Web应用程序。其主要目的是帮助开发者在微信小程序生态中,利用Web技术开发小程序,简化开发流程,降低门槛。H5小程序微信开发的原理如下:1.微信小程序开发环境的搭建:开发者需要下载微信开发者工具,创建小程序项目,并选
2023-08-09
cocos小程序休闲类游戏开发
Cocos小程序是基于微信小程序开发的一款轻量级游戏引擎,可以快速构建移动端休闲游戏,包括跑酷、消除、益智等类型的游戏。本文将详细介绍如何利用Cocos小程序进行休闲类游戏开发。一、Cocos小程序介绍Cocos小程序是由Cocos官方推出的一款专门为微信
2023-08-09
小程序开发工具没有
小程序是指基于微信平台打造的应用程序,通过微信扫码或搜索公众号进入,可以完成各种功能,包括购物、预约、服务等等。小程序开发工具是开发小程序所必须的工具,它是一个能够帮助开发者在本地开发、调试和模拟小程序的软件,方便开发者进行快速的开发和测试。小程序开发工具
2023-05-26
小程序开发工具模拟器如何实现的运行
小程序开发工具模拟器是一种可以让开发者在本地进行小程序开发及调试的工具。模拟器可以模拟微信客户端的一些功能,比如网络请求、位置信息、设备信息等等,使得开发者可以在没有真实环境的情况下进行开发及测试。模拟器的实现原理主要分为以下几个方面:1. 小程序开发工具
2023-05-26
微信小程序开发工具怎么测试数据
微信小程序是腾讯推出的一种新型应用方式,它不仅仅可以在微信中使用,而且还可以在微信开发者工具中进行开发。微信开发者工具提供了一种方便的测试数据方式,用于开发者在调试微信小程序时使用。微信小程序开发工具测试数据的原理微信小程序测试数据是通过模拟微信小程序的一
2023-05-26
江苏智能硬件类小程序开发工具
江苏智能硬件类小程序开发工具是一套用于开发智能硬件的小程序的工具。它为开发者提供了一种简便的方式来开发能够与智能硬件进行通信的小程序,以便让用户控制和监控他们的智能硬件设备。在本文中,我们将对江苏智能硬件类小程序开发工具的工作原理和具体介绍进行详细讨论。一
2023-05-26
网页怎么跳转到小程序
随着移动互联网的快速发展,小程序成为了互联网领域的一种新型应用形态,越来越多的企业和开发者开始关注和使用小程序。而在网页中跳转到小程序,也成为了一种常见的需求。本文将介绍网页跳转到小程序的原理和详细操作方法。一、原理网页跳转到小程序的原理主要是通过调用小程
2023-04-06